Better Energy Efficiency

As householders explore solutions to cut energy costs, rooflights provide a compelling solution by boosting natural light and decreasing reliance on artificial lighting. By allowing daylight to penetrate deeper into living spaces, rooflights can considerably lower the need for electric lights during daytime hours. This transition not only cuts energy bills but also fosters a more sustainable lifestyle.

Furthermore, the use of thermally efficient glazing in rooflights can serve to control indoor temperatures. Premium materials can reduce heat loss during winter months and lower heat gain in hotter seasons, thus reducing heating and cooling expenses. Furthermore, rooflights can increase ventilation when constructed with operable features, enabling airflow and decreasing the need for air conditioning. On the whole, installing rooflights is a strategic investment that delivers sustained savings while supporting energy-saving goals, making them an attractive option for sustainability-focused homeowners.

Enhanced Ventilation and Air Quality

Rooflights notably boost ventilation and air quality in a home. By creating natural light and enabling airflow, rooflights assist in control indoor temperatures. They establish a favorable environment by allowing warm air to escape, which is crucial during summer months. This process not only cools the space but also reduces the requirement on artificial cooling systems, leading to energy savings.

Furthermore, rooflights facilitate the flow of fresh air, effectively minimizing indoor pollutants and allergens. Stagnant air is swapped for purer, outdoor air, which can significantly enhance respiratory health. This is particularly advantageous for individuals with allergies or asthma, as the reduction of airborne irritants contributes to a healthier living environment.

In addition, rooflights can help to decrease excessive humidity, lowering the risk of mold growth, which can also compromise air quality. On the whole, the incorporation of rooflights is a effective solution for improving both ventilation and the overall ambiance of a home.

Questions & Answers

How Do Rooflights Influence Home Insulation Throughout Winter?

Roof windows can enhance property insulation in winter by permitting natural light while decreasing heat loss. If installed correctly, they can help to maintain indoor temperatures, minimize the need for artificial heating, and contribute to energy efficiency.

What Maintenance Do Rooflights Require?

Regular maintenance of rooflights involves wiping glass surfaces, checking seals for leaks, examining frames for damage, and maintaining proper drainage. Addressing issues immediately can extend their lifespan and preserve energy efficiency throughout the year.

Are Rooflights Compatible with All Roof Types?

Rooflights are typically appropriate for various roof types, including flat and pitched roofs. Nevertheless, certain installation requirements and structural considerations can vary, calling for professional assessment to confirm compatibility and optimal performance in different settings.

Can Rooflights Assist in Reducing Heating Bills?

Rooflights can help reduce heating costs by allowing natural light to penetrate, which can warm spaces during the day. Professionally installed rooflights also enhance improved insulation, limiting heat loss and improving energy efficiency.

Which Rooflight Materials Are Most Recommended?

Polycarbonate, tempered glass, and acrylic are among the best rooflight materials available. Each material delivers unique advantages concerning insulation, durability, and light transmission, permitting homeowners to make choices based on their individual needs and preferences.
